Ridge was born on January 9th with a rare birth defect called esophageal atresia, meaning his esophagus did not fully form to connect to his stomach. He underwent surgery shortly after birth to repair it, and the procedure itself was successful. Since then, however, there have been additional complications that have made it unsafe for him to come home. Ridge currently has a feeding tube and will likely go home with one as well. They are also waiting for approval for another surgery to repair his trachea collapsing. That procedure will need to be done out of state, and at this time they are unsure how long recovery will take. It could mean being away from home for several more weeks.
